Amanda Kannard, AICP, LPM
Amanda Kannard is an urban planner, designer, and project manager with over seven years of experience in the planning field, and is currently a Senior Associate at Progressive Urban Management Associates (P.U.M.A.). Amanda works on a diversity of projects, from neighborhood, downtown, and corridor plans, to comprehensive community engagement efforts, to strategic visioning and organizational plans. Prior to joining P.U.M.A., Amanda gained urban design, public engagement, and research experience at urban planning consulting firms in the Chicago and Los Angeles regions and gained public sector planning experience in place management organizations in Chicago during her time as a graduate student at the University of Illinois at Chicago.
Alyssa Knutson, AICP
Alyssa Knutson is an AICP-certified planner that earned her Masters in Urban and Regional Planning from the University of Colorado Denver in 2013. Since then, she has worked in the planning profession in both the public and private sectors, which includes 8 years as a planner for the City of Fort Lupton and over 2½ years in her current position as a land use planner at Otten Johnson Robinson Neff + Ragonetti PC.
Prior to pursuing a career in planning, Alyssa worked in legal support in different legal settings. She has also previously served as a planning commissioner for the City of Glendale, Colorado, a board member of the City Park West Registered Neighborhood Organization, and as a chair for the alumni association of her undergraduate alma mater, Colorado State University. She looks forward to serving as a Denver Metro Area Representative and providing opportunities for Denver area planners to come together in meaningful ways to discuss planning issues, successes, and experiences.
